House’s Power Standing Coverage Determination Letter Sent to CMS with 22 Signatures
The Complex Rehab Technology industry continues to push for a Medicare coverage determination for power standing on power wheelchairs.
The “Dear Colleague” letter from members of Congress was sent to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) Administrator Chiquita Brooks-LaSure with 22 signatures.
